Dai Jones

Dai Jones

Rank: Private

Regiment: ‘D’ Company, South Wales Borderers

Other Info: Won the ten round boxing contest in the Hastings Pier Pavilion last Thursday, and who is fighting for the County Championship at the same place next week. It was through Private Jones offering to box for local charities that the Assault at Arms new being carried out in Hastings came about.

Published: January 1915
